Cass Soil and Water Conservation District (SWCD) is a governmental organization that promotes the responsible management of soil and water resources in Cass County, Minnesota.
Landowners, farmers, and residents in Cass County may be required to file with the Cass SWCD depending on their land use practices.
To fill out Cass SWCD forms, landowners can visit the Cass SWCD office or website to access the necessary documents and instructions.
The purpose of Cass SWCD is to conserve and protect soil and water resources, promote sustainable land use practices, and provide educational programs to the community.
Information that must be reported on Cass SWCD forms includes land use practices, conservation measures taken, and any potential risks to soil and water quality.
